小白求助 网站自动转向https
时间 : 2024-03-18 00:23:03声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

确保你的网站已经安装了SSL证书,并且服务器支持HTTPS协议。接下来,你可以通过在网站的根目录下创建一个名为".htaccess"的文件,并在其中添加以下代码来实现自动转向HTTPS:

RewriteEngine On

RewriteCond %{HTTPS} off

RewriteRule ^ https://%{HTTP_HOST}%{REQUEST_URI} [L,R=301]

保存并上传文件到你的网站根目录,然后刷新你的网站,现在访问网站时应该会自动跳转到HTTPS安全连接。如果你的网站使用其他类型的服务器,比如Nginx,则需要相应修改配置文件来实现自动转向HTTPS。

其他答案

要让网站自动转向HTTPS,首先你需要确保你的网站已经拥有了SSL证书。SSL证书是实现网站HTTPS加密连接的关键。然后,你需要在网站的服务器上进行一些设置,具体步骤如下:

1. 登录到你的网站的服务器控制面板或者通过FTP登录到服务器。

2. 找到网站根目录下的.htaccess文件,如果没有该文件,则需要创建一个新的.htaccess文件。

3. 在.htaccess文件中添加以下代码来进行重定向:

RewriteEngine On

RewriteCond %{HTTPS} off

RewriteRule ^ https://%{HTTP_HOST}%{REQUEST_URI} [L,R=301]

这段代码的作用是检查当前请求是否是HTTP协议,如果是,则重定向到HTTPS协议。确保在编辑.htaccess文件时不要破坏现有的代码。

4. 保存并上传.htaccess文件到网站根目录。

完成以上步骤后,访问你的网站时会自动转向HTTPS协议,确保数据传输加密安全。如果你在设置过程中遇到问题,可以咨询你的主机商或者服务器管理员寻求帮助。希望对你有帮助,祝你顺利实现网站自动转向HTTPS!